Precious Metals IRA vs 401(k): A Retirement Investment Comparison
Deciding between the best retirement investment strategy can be a daunting task. Two popular options are the Gold IRA and the traditional 401(k). Both offer valuable benefits for long-term financial security, but they function differently and suit various investor needs. A Gold IRA allows you to invest in physical gold, silver, platinum, or palladium, offering a hedge against inflation and market volatility. Conversely, a 401(k) is a retirement savings plan provided by your employer, typically offering tax advantages and potential employer matching contributions.
To make the most informed decision, it's crucial to carefully consider your financial goals, risk tolerance, and investment horizon. Factors like age, income level, and existing retirement savings also play a role in determining which option is right for you. Consulting with a qualified financial advisor can provide personalized guidance and help one create a comprehensive retirement plan that aligns with your unique circumstances.
